According to the latest news from TRT Spor, an agreement was reached between Beşiktaş and Benfica regarding the transfer of Rafa Silva. According to the news, Benfica will pay a transfer fee of 6 million euros to Beşiktaş for Rafa Silva. It was reported that the agreement also included a performance-related bonus clause of 1 million euros. Thus, the total cost of the transfer could reach up to 7 million euros.

In the news published in the Portuguese press A Bola, it was emphasized that Benfica’s current financial relations with Beşiktaş played a decisive role in the Rafa Silva transfer. Accordingly, it was stated that the Portuguese team will receive a guarantee fee of 25 million euros and a performance-related bonus of 5 million euros from Beşiktaş within the scope of the Orkun Kökçü transfer, and will also earn 10 million euros in July from the sale of the remaining 50 percent of Gedson Fernandes’ transfer rights. It was shared that the amounts in question were on the table as an offsetting element in the payments to be made for the Rafa transfer.
The 32-year-old offensive player, who joined the squad in the 2024 summer transfer window, managed to become one of the team’s top scorers during the time. However, after the bad results and the changes of president and coach in Beşiktaş, it was stated that Rafa Silva was not happy with this situation and wanted to leave the team. When long meetings with President Serdal Adalı and Sergen Yalçın did not yield any results, the star player left the team alone in recent months. Silva, who played 65 matches for Beşiktaş, scored 23 goals and 16 assists.
